Monthly sales tax revenue tops $977 million

Texas Comptroller Glenn Hegar announced he would be sending cities, counties, transit systems and special purpose districts $977.2 million in local sales tax allocations for April, 12.8% more than in April 2022.

‘I Am Texas’ stops in Orange

The Guinness World Record certified largest published book in the world, “I Am Texas,” will be on display at the Stark Museum of Art through July 29.

Free Family Fun Day

The Museum of the Gulf Coast and the Port Arthur Convention & Visitors Bureau are teaming up to present a free Family Fun Day that is “For the Birds!” as part of the city of Port Arthur’s 125th Year of Celebration. Guests will be admitted to visit the museum for free from 10 a.m. until 1p.m.

Salvation Army Thrift Store closes

The Salvation Army Thrift Store held its final sale April 20 and 21 at 4925 College Street in Beaumont, clearing out all inventory as well as some merchandising stands and shelves.

LIT students show off Skills

Lamar Institute of Technology (LIT) students competed in the state SkillsUSA Post-Secondary competition April 13-15 in Houston, taking home 17 gold, six silver and two bronze medals.
